Understanding Tsunamis: What Are They?
Tsunamis are powerful series of ocean waves caused by large-scale disturbances, most commonly underwater earthquakes. These aren't your everyday beach waves; tsunamis can travel across entire oceans and cause immense destruction when they reach coastal areas. Understanding the science behind tsunamis is the first step in preparing for them. When an earthquake occurs on the ocean floor, it can suddenly displace massive amounts of water. This displacement generates waves that radiate outward in all directions from the epicenter. Unlike wind-driven waves, tsunamis involve the entire water column, from the surface to the seabed, which is why they carry so much energy. In the open ocean, tsunamis have long wavelengths, sometimes hundreds of kilometers, and relatively small heights, often less than a meter. This makes them difficult to detect at sea, and ships may not even notice their passage. However, as a tsunami approaches shallower coastal waters, its speed decreases, and its height increases dramatically. This phenomenon, known as shoaling, is what makes tsunamis so dangerous. The towering waves can inundate coastal areas, causing widespread flooding, erosion, and structural damage. The force of the water can demolish buildings, uproot trees, and sweep away vehicles. In addition to earthquakes, tsunamis can also be triggered by underwater landslides, volcanic eruptions, and even meteorite impacts. While these events are less common than earthquakes, they can still generate significant tsunamis. For instance, a large underwater landslide can displace a substantial volume of water, creating a localized tsunami that can impact nearby coastlines. Similarly, a powerful volcanic eruption can cause both direct displacement of water and subsequent landslides, leading to tsunami generation. Understanding the different causes of tsunamis helps us appreciate the various scenarios that can lead to a tsunami warning. Being aware of these potential triggers allows us to be more vigilant and proactive in our preparedness efforts. Remember, tsunamis are not single waves; they are a series of waves that can continue for hours. The first wave may not be the largest, so itβs crucial to stay vigilant even after the initial wave arrives. Tsunami Warning System: How It Works
The tsunami warning system is a complex network of sensors, communication systems, and emergency protocols designed to detect tsunamis and alert coastal communities in a timely manner. This system is crucial for saving lives and minimizing damage when a tsunami is imminent. The process begins with the detection of a potential tsunami-generating event, typically a large underwater earthquake. Seismic monitoring networks around the world continuously record ground movements, and when an earthquake of sufficient magnitude occurs, the data is analyzed to determine the likelihood of a tsunami. Factors such as the earthquake's magnitude, depth, and location are considered. If the earthquake meets certain criteria, such as a magnitude of 7.0 or higher, a tsunami watch or warning may be issued. A tsunami watch means that a tsunami is possible, and coastal communities should be aware and prepared to take action. This is an early alert that allows people to gather information and make preliminary preparations. A tsunami warning, on the other hand, indicates that a tsunami is imminent or expected, and immediate evacuation of coastal areas is recommended. This is a serious alert that requires swift action to ensure safety. The warning system relies on a network of Deep-ocean Assessment and Reporting of Tsunamis (DART) buoys. These buoys are strategically placed in the ocean to detect changes in sea level caused by tsunamis. Each buoy is equipped with a bottom pressure sensor that measures the pressure of the water column above it. When a tsunami passes over the sensor, it causes a slight change in pressure, which is then transmitted to a surface buoy. The surface buoy relays the data via satellite to tsunami warning centers. These centers, such as the Pacific Tsunami Warning Center (PTWC) and the National Tsunami Warning Center (NTWC), analyze the data from the DART buoys and other sources to confirm the existence of a tsunami and forecast its potential impact. The centers use sophisticated computer models to predict the tsunami's arrival time and wave height at different coastal locations. This information is then disseminated to emergency management agencies, media outlets, and the public through various channels, including radio, television, internet, and mobile alerts. In addition to the technical infrastructure, effective communication and coordination are essential components of the tsunami warning system. Emergency management agencies play a vital role in disseminating warnings to the public and coordinating evacuation efforts. They work with local communities to develop evacuation plans, identify safe zones, and conduct drills to ensure that residents know what to do in the event of a tsunami. Southern California: Tsunami Risk and History
Southern California faces a notable risk of tsunamis due to its location along the Pacific Ring of Fire, a seismically active region that encircles the Pacific Ocean. This area is characterized by frequent earthquakes and volcanic activity, which can trigger tsunamis that impact coastal communities worldwide. Understanding Southern California's specific risk and historical events helps us appreciate the importance of preparedness. The primary sources of tsunamis that could affect Southern California are distant earthquakes, particularly those occurring in the Pacific Ocean basin. Large earthquakes off the coasts of Alaska, Japan, Chile, and other countries can generate tsunamis that travel across the Pacific and reach the California coastline. These distant tsunamis can arrive several hours after the earthquake, providing some time for warning and evacuation, but they can still be very dangerous. In addition to distant earthquakes, local earthquakes along California's coast can also generate tsunamis. While these local tsunamis may not be as large as those generated by distant earthquakes, they can arrive much more quickly, sometimes within minutes of the earthquake. This rapid arrival time makes them particularly hazardous because there may not be enough time for official warnings to be issued and for people to evacuate. Southern California has experienced several tsunamis throughout its history, although most have been relatively small. One of the most significant events was the 1964 Alaska earthquake tsunami, which caused damage along the California coast, including harbors and marinas. The tsunami resulted in flooding and damage to boats and infrastructure, highlighting the potential impact of distant tsunamis. Another notable event was the 2011 Japan earthquake and tsunami, which generated a tsunami that reached California several hours later. While the waves were not as large as those in Japan, they still caused strong currents and surges in harbors and bays, resulting in damage to docks and vessels. These historical events serve as reminders of the ongoing tsunami risk in Southern California and the importance of being prepared. While large, destructive tsunamis are relatively rare, smaller tsunamis occur more frequently and can still pose a threat to coastal areas. The topography of Southern California's coastline also plays a role in the tsunami risk. Certain areas, such as bays and harbors, can amplify tsunami waves, leading to higher water levels and stronger currents. Low-lying coastal areas are also particularly vulnerable to inundation. Recognizing these vulnerable areas is essential for effective evacuation planning. To mitigate the risk of tsunamis, Southern California has implemented various preparedness measures, including the development of tsunami inundation maps, the installation of tsunami warning sirens in some coastal communities, and the conduct of regular tsunami drills. These efforts are aimed at educating the public about tsunami hazards and ensuring that people know what to do in the event of a tsunami warning. Receiving Tsunami Warnings: Stay Informed
Staying informed is key to receiving tsunami warnings promptly and taking appropriate action. There are several channels through which tsunami warnings are disseminated, and it's essential to know how to access them. Understanding the different warning systems ensures you're always in the loop. One of the primary sources of tsunami warnings is the official alerts issued by the National Weather Service (NWS) and the National Tsunami Warning Center (NTWC). These warnings are broadcast through various channels, including:
- NOAA Weather Radio: This is a nationwide network of radio stations broadcasting weather and hazard information 24 hours a day. NOAA Weather Radio is an excellent resource for receiving real-time alerts about tsunamis and other emergencies.
- Wireless Emergency Alerts (WEA): These are text-like messages sent to mobile phones in affected areas. WEA alerts are used to disseminate critical information, including tsunami warnings, during emergencies. Make sure your mobile phone is enabled to receive WEA alerts.
- Local Media: Television and radio stations often broadcast tsunami warnings and provide updates on the situation. Check your local news channels for the latest information.
- Internet and Social Media: Many websites and social media platforms, such as the NWS and local emergency management agencies, provide real-time updates on tsunami warnings. Follow these official sources to stay informed.
In addition to these official channels, some coastal communities have installed tsunami warning sirens. These sirens are designed to alert people in immediate coastal areas of an impending tsunami. If you hear a tsunami siren, it's crucial to evacuate to higher ground immediately. It's important to note that sirens are typically used as a last-resort warning system and may not be audible in all areas. Therefore, it's essential to rely on multiple sources of information to receive tsunami warnings. Having a personal emergency plan is crucial. This includes knowing evacuation routes, identifying safe zones, and having a communication plan with your family. Discussing these plans with your family and practicing them regularly can help ensure that everyone knows what to do in the event of a tsunami warning. Another way to stay informed is to sign up for local emergency alert systems. Many cities and counties offer alert services that send notifications via text message, email, or phone call about emergencies, including tsunamis. These alerts can provide timely and specific information about the situation in your area. Remember, the more ways you have to receive tsunami warnings, the better prepared you will be. What to Do During a Tsunami Warning: Safety Measures
Knowing what to do during a tsunami warning is crucial for your safety and the safety of those around you. When a warning is issued, time is of the essence, and having a plan in place can make all the difference. Let's walk through the essential safety measures to take when a tsunami threatens. First and foremost, if you receive a tsunami warning, evacuate immediately to higher ground. Don't wait to see the wave; tsunamis can travel faster than you can run, and the first wave may not be the largest. Head for the highest ground possible, as far inland as you can. If you are in a designated evacuation zone, follow the evacuation routes established by local emergency management agencies. These routes are designed to lead you to safe areas as quickly and efficiently as possible. If you are not in an evacuation zone but are near the coast, move inland as far as you can. The general rule of thumb is to evacuate at least one mile inland or to a height of 100 feet above sea level. Don't assume that you are safe just because you are on a hill; tsunamis can surge up rivers and streams, so it's essential to move away from waterways as well. If you are on a boat when a tsunami warning is issued, the best course of action is to head out to deep water. Tsunamis are less dangerous in the open ocean, where the waves are smaller. However, be sure to monitor the situation closely and follow the instructions of the authorities. If you are caught in a tsunami, try to grab onto something that floats, such as a log, a door, or a piece of debris. Use the floating object to stay above the water and protect yourself from being swept away. Once you have reached a safe location, stay there until authorities have given the all-clear. Tsunamis are not single waves; they are a series of waves that can continue for hours. The first wave may not be the largest, and subsequent waves can be even more dangerous. Continue to monitor official sources of information, such as NOAA Weather Radio, local media, and emergency management agencies, for updates. Avoid returning to the coast until authorities have determined that it is safe to do so. The receding water after a tsunami can be just as dangerous as the incoming waves, as it can create strong currents and expose debris. After the tsunami, be aware of potential hazards, such as downed power lines, damaged buildings, and contaminated water. Report any hazards to the authorities and avoid areas that are obviously unsafe. Remember, the key to surviving a tsunami is to act quickly and decisively. Preparing for a Tsunami: Be Ready
Being prepared for a tsunami is not just about knowing what to do during a warning; it's about taking proactive steps to mitigate the risk and ensure your safety and the safety of your loved ones. Let's explore some essential steps you can take to prepare for a tsunami. One of the most important things you can do is to develop a family emergency plan. This plan should outline what to do in the event of a tsunami, including evacuation routes, meeting locations, and communication strategies. Discuss the plan with all family members and practice it regularly through drills. Make sure everyone knows where to go, how to get there, and who to contact in case of an emergency. Another crucial aspect of tsunami preparedness is to assemble an emergency kit. This kit should contain essential supplies that you may need if you have to evacuate or shelter in place. Some key items to include in your emergency kit are:
- Water (at least one gallon per person per day)
- Non-perishable food (enough for at least three days)
- First-aid kit
- Flashlight and extra batteries
- Whistle
- Radio (battery-powered or hand-crank)
- Medications
- Personal hygiene items
- Copies of important documents
- Cash
Store your emergency kit in a convenient and easily accessible location, such as a closet or under the bed. Make sure everyone in the family knows where the kit is and how to use the supplies. In addition to having an emergency kit, it's also important to know your community's tsunami evacuation plan. Contact your local emergency management agency to learn about evacuation routes, safe zones, and other preparedness measures in your area. Familiarize yourself with the tsunami hazard zone in your community and identify the safest routes to higher ground. If you live in a coastal area, consider purchasing flood insurance. Standard homeowners insurance policies typically do not cover flood damage, so flood insurance is essential for protecting your property from the impacts of a tsunami.
